     Your Committee on Human Services, to which was referred H.B. No. 673 entitled:

 

"A BILL FOR AN ACT RELATING TO CHILD CARE FACILITIES,"

 

begs leave to report as follows:

 

     The purpose of this measure is to improve oversight over child care facilities by:

 

(1)  Establishing the Child Care Facility Inspection Information Oversight Committee (Oversight Committee) to oversee implementation of and compliance with Department of Human Services (DHS) child care facility record requirements under Section 346-153(c), Hawaii Revised Statutes;

 

(2)  Requiring DHS to post child care facility inspection reports on its website;

 

(3)  Requiring DHS to submit annual reports to the Legislature on child care facility complaints; and

 

(4)  Appropriating funds for DHS to implement and comply with the reporting requirements for child care facilities.

 

     Numerous individuals testified in support of this measure.  DHS, Hawaii Children's Action Network, and several individuals commented on this measure.

     Your Committee has amended this measure by:

 

(1)  Deleting the Oversight Committee;

 

(2)  Requiring DHS to post reports of all child care facility inspections on its website within 30 working days of the conclusion of each inspection;

 

(3)  Changing its effective date to July 1, 2075, to encourage further discussion; and

 

(4)  Making technical, nonsubstantive amendments for clarity, consistency, and style.

 

     Should the Committee on Finance hear this measure, your Committee respectfully requests that it consider appropriating $80,000 for each year of the 2017-2019 Fiscal Biennium to implement and comply with the reporting requirements for child care facilities as required by this measure.

 

     As affirmed by the record of votes of the members of your Committee on Human Services that is attached to this report, your Committee is in accord with the intent and purpose of H.B. No. 673, as amended herein, and recommends that it pass Second Reading in the form attached hereto as H.B. No. 673, H.D. 1, and be referred to your Committee on Finance.
